Herres Sekt, a distinguished name in the sparkling wine industry, is headquartered in Germany (DE) and has established a strong presence in various operational regions across Europe. Founded in the early 20th century, the company has achieved significant milestones, including the development of unique production techniques that enhance the quality of its offerings. Specialising in high-quality sekt, Herres Sekt is renowned for its meticulous craftsmanship and commitment to using premium grapes sourced from select vineyards. This dedication to quality sets it apart in a competitive market, allowing the brand to maintain a notable position among sparkling wine producers. With a focus on innovation and tradition, Herres Sekt continues to delight connoisseurs and casual drinkers alike, solidifying its reputation as a leader in the sekt industry.

Herres Sekt, headquartered in Germany (DE), currently does not have available data on carbon emissions, as no specific emissions figures have been provided.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ges outlined in their initiatives. This lack of information suggests that Herres Sekt may still be in the early stages of formalising its climate commitments or reporting on its carbon footprint.
